The Royal British Legion is embarking on a significant phase of digital and organisational transformation. As part of our newly formed Data, Technology and Transformation Directorate, we are seeking an experienced and forward-thinking Director: Technology to shape and lead the next stage of our technology strategy. This is a newly redefined role, evolved to align with the ambitions set out in our refreshed organisational strategy. The remit has expanded significantly, reflecting the need for a more integrated, modern, and strategic approach to how technology enables our services, supports operational excellence, and drives long-term value.

Building on our previous efforts, we are now seeking a technology leader who truly understands how to design and govern modern ecosystems of applications, with particular expertise in Microsoft platforms and enterprise technologies. You will lead a team of senior Heads across engineering, architecture, cyber security, testing and operations, providing clear direction while fostering a culture of modern delivery, continuous improvement, and cross-functional collaboration.

The role requires a strategic mindset and the ability to align complex technology programmes with broader organisational objectives. Experience of agile and flow-based delivery models, modern service design, and scalable platforms will be key. You will be contracted to our London Hub, Haig House. Under our Future Working framework, there will be some flexibility for working remotely/at home, using our collaboration tools to work with colleagues, but with a minimum expectation of two days per week connecting directly face-to-face with colleagues at the hub.

Employee benefits include:

  • 28 days paid holiday (plus bank holidays) increasing with service, with optional annual leave purchase scheme of up to 5 working days
  • Private Healthcare
  • Generous pension contributions, with Employer contributions ranging from 6% to 14%
  • Range of flexible working options may be available, depending on your role
  • Employee Assistance Programme providing confidential counselling, financial and legal advice
  • Range of courses delivered by learning specialists to support your development goals and objectives
  • Opportunities to volunteer
  • Travel loans, Cycle to Work, and more!
